Dining out is not just about food -it is an experience shaped by service, ambience, and cultural expectations. In Egypt, two distinct types of restaurants dominate the scene: casual dining and fine dining. Both styles appeal to different audiences, occasions, and budgets. While casual dining focuses on comfort and accessibility, fine dining emphasizes refinement and exclusivity. Defining Casual Dining
Relaxed Atmosphere
Casual dining restaurants prioritize comfort. They often feature warm interiors, simple table settings, and a welcoming environment.
Affordable Choices
Menus are designed to be budget-friendly, offering hearty portions at accessible prices.
Social and Family-Friendly
Casual dining encourages group gatherings, making it ideal for families, friends, or colleagues.

Defining Fine Dining
Luxury Ambience
Fine dining restaurants offer elegant décor, sophisticated lighting, and carefully curated music to set a refined tone.
Premium Menus
Dishes are prepared using high-quality, seasonal ingredients, often with innovative techniques and artistic presentation.
Attentive Service
Service is polished, discreet, and designed to anticipate guests’ needs without intruding on their experience.

When Egyptians Prefer Each Style
Everyday Dining
Casual dining is preferred for daily meals, family outings, or quick social gatherings.
Special Occasions
Fine dining is chosen for anniversaries, proposals, business dinners, or celebratory events.
Changing Preferences
Younger generations are increasingly exploring fine dining, influenced by global food culture and social media trends.
